Ok, in our first couple of issues we talked a little about self-maintenance and the importance of putting ourselves first.  But, let’s take a step back and address what being a “funky mama” is all about.

A funky mama is more about a state of mind than an outward appearance.  The funky mama is our modern day version of the Proverbs 31 woman (Proverbs 31: 1-31).  This woman was phenomenal!

She managed her household, took great care of her family, kept herself looking well, invested in business and real estate, helped those in need, and always had faithful instruction on her tongue.  This woman didn’t have to seek respect; she commanded it!

The purpose of One Funky Mama is to remind moms to not step back or step down in our households or in life.  Many of us are familiar with the famous quote by Marianne Williamson, “…You are a child of God.  Your playing small does not serve the world.  There is nothing enlightening about shrinking so that other people won’t feel unsure around you.  We were born to make manifest the glory of God that is within us.  It is not just in some of us; it is in everyone…”

This quote is especially true for moms, we often shrink back to allow others to shine.  Oprah coined the term women who’ve “let themselves go”.  Yeah, that holds so true for us.  We stay in “comfortable” (a nice word for dowdy) clothes, don’t keep our hair done as much anymore, and don’t even ask us about maintaining anything else!

But, it’s about so much more than just keeping our look together.  It’s about choosing to value ourselves enough to care about our total well-being.  And, that means re-introducing ourselves to self-care and wellness, as well as, re-igniting our passion for life.  This is the only life journey we get, so doesn’t it make sense to make the most of it?

The sole purpose of One Funky Mama is to help us get in touch with the woman that God created us to be.  Despite being mothers, along with our myriad of other roles, we were first born Pam, Donna, Latysha, or Lynn.  Let’s reintroduce ourselves and take the time to show us that we are appreciative…of us!

No matter what, know that you’re here and you have soooo much value.  Feel special, because you certainly are!
